Seasonal Floor Care Tips for Healthy Hardwood Surfaces

Hardwood residential hardwood floor refinishing pittsburgh require special attention throughout the year to maintain their beauty and prevent damage. Seasonal changes affect wood moisture levels, temperature, and wear, making adjustments in care practices necessary.

During winter, dry indoor air can cause wood to shrink or develop gaps. Summer humidity may lead to swelling or cupping. Seasonal cleaning routines, humidity management, and protective measures help prevent long-term damage.

The concept of seasonality reflects the importance of adjusting care routines based on environmental conditions. Monitoring changes in temperature and humidity ensures floors remain stable and visually appealing.

Implementing Year-Round Maintenance

Use humidifiers or dehumidifiers as needed, rotate rugs to prevent uneven wear, and inspect for scratches or dents regularly. Seasonal deep cleaning and polishing further maintain the protective finish.

By following seasonal care tips, homeowners can extend the life of hardwood floors, preserving both their appearance and structural integrity throughout the year.…

Attic And Wall Insulation Options For Better Home Efficiency

Attic and wall commercial insulation are essential components of an energy-efficient home. These areas often account for the greatest amount of heat loss in a building, especially in older homes with outdated insulation systems. Proper insulation in these spaces helps maintain consistent indoor temperatures and reduces the workload on heating and cooling systems.

There are several types of insulation materials suitable for attics and walls. Fiberglass batts are among the most common options because they are affordable and easy to install. Loose-fill insulation is another popular choice for attics, as it can fill irregular spaces and provide even coverage across large areas.

The effectiveness of insulation is measured using thermal resistance, which determines how well a material slows heat transfer. Many insulation products rely on materials such as cellulose, which is known for its environmentally friendly properties and effective thermal performance.

Choosing The Right Insulation For Each Space

Different areas of a home require different insulation approaches. Attics often benefit from thicker layers of loose-fill or spray foam insulation, while wall cavities are typically filled with batts or foam-based materials. The correct choice depends on factors such as climate, building design, and budget.

Professional installation ensures that insulation performs as intended. Contractors carefully seal gaps, install materials evenly, and ensure that ventilation systems remain functional. With the right insulation strategy, homeowners can significantly improve energy efficiency and overall indoor comfort.

Research Peptides in Experimental Biochemistry

USA peptide company often relies on peptides to model and investigate complex biological systems. Because peptides can mimic specific segments of larger proteins, researchers use them to study enzyme activity, receptor interactions, and molecular signaling pathways in controlled laboratory environments. Their defined sequences allow for targeted experimental design and measurable outcomes.

Peptides used in research undergo stringent synthesis and purification processes to ensure consistency. High-performance analytical testing confirms molecular weight, purity percentage, and structural accuracy before laboratory integration. These quality-control measures are essential to preserve experimental reliability and avoid misleading results.

It must be clearly stated that research peptides are intended strictly for laboratory research purposes only. They are not approved for human consumption, medical procedures, or therapeutic use. Responsible sourcing and professional laboratory handling are required at all times.

Biochemical Interaction Studies

In many experimental setups, peptides are examined for their interaction with biological components such as enzymes. By observing how peptides bind or influence enzymatic activity, researchers gain insight into broader biochemical mechanisms.

Controlled studies may involve varying concentrations, environmental conditions, or molecular modifications to evaluate changes in performance. Such investigations contribute to foundational scientific knowledge in molecular biology and related disciplines.

Research peptides remain valuable instruments in experimental biochemistry, offering precision and adaptability in laboratory studies. Nonetheless, their designated purpose remains exclusively for controlled scientific research—not for human use under any circumstances.…

Bathroom Renovation Best Practices for Lasting Results

Bathroom renovations require careful planning due to plumbing, Home Renovation, and moisture control considerations. Unlike cosmetic upgrades in other rooms, bathroom remodeling often involves technical systems that must comply with building codes. Proper preparation reduces the risk of leaks, mold growth, and costly repairs in the future.

Begin by assessing layout efficiency and fixture placement. Relocating plumbing significantly increases costs, so retaining existing configurations can be budget-friendly. Selecting water-efficient fixtures and durable materials enhances both sustainability and longevity. Professional waterproofing is essential, especially in shower areas and around tubs.

Understanding the role of proper plumbing systems in bathroom renovations helps homeowners make informed decisions. Adequate drainage, ventilation, and sealing techniques are critical for maintaining structural integrity. Consulting experienced contractors ensures that all technical elements meet safety standards.

Prioritizing Durability and Comfort

High-quality tile, moisture-resistant paint, and reliable fixtures are long-term investments. Heated flooring, improved lighting, and modern vanities enhance comfort while maintaining practicality. Thoughtful design ensures the space remains functional for years without frequent maintenance.

A successful bathroom renovation balances technical precision with aesthetic appeal. With expert guidance and durable materials, homeowners can achieve a stylish, comfortable, and resilient space.


Spray Foam Insulation Safety Overview

Spray foam insulation is widely recognized for its superior air sealing and thermal performance, but safety considerations are critical during installation. The material expands rapidly to fill gaps and cracks, creating an effective barrier against air infiltration. However, the application process involves chemical components that must be handled properly to ensure installer and occupant safety.

Spray foam insulation, professionals wear protective equipment to guard against exposure to vapors and particulates. Proper ventilation is essential to allow curing and off-gassing to occur safely. Once fully cured, spray foam insulation is generally considered stable and inert, posing minimal risk to occupants when installed correctly.

Industry guidance often references standards from the Occupational Safety and Health Administration regarding protective practices and exposure limits. These standards outline requirements for respiratory protection, ventilation, and safe handling procedures. Compliance with established safety protocols significantly reduces installation-related risks.

Ensuring Safe and Effective Installation

Hiring trained and certified professionals is essential when installing spray foam insulation. Experienced contractors understand appropriate mixing ratios, application techniques, and curing times. Improper installation can lead to performance issues or lingering odors.

Homeowners should also confirm that installers provide clear re-entry guidelines following application. Observing safety best practices ensures that spray foam delivers its intended benefits without compromising health or indoor air quality.
